One of Robert Half's longstanding clients - a boutique firm with offices in Glendale and Beverly Hills - is seeking an employment law attorney. This position is hybrid; the employment law attorney should be able to commute to Glendale at least once a week (ideally more, or another day in Beverly Hills). This vibrant union-side practice focuses on representing multi-employer employee benefit trust funds, public and private sector unions, and union-affiliated PACs.
This firm is looking for an employment lawyer with at least 3 years of litigation experience. This role will involve legal research and writing, trial prep, and drafting motions (including those for summary judgements). Exposure to employee benefits / ERISA is extremely helpful. Pay is contingent upon labor & employment law experience; please do not reply without any.
This labor & employment firm represents union, often for construction and trade workers. The team is comprised of a likeable group of attorneys and long-standing support staff (who are all union employees themselves and have great benefits!). Attorneys typically stay here for years! Some attorneys have been with firm for 15-20 years. The support staff and partners are great. We have made successful placements at this firm before, and candidates rave about mentorship.

The Sentinel Firm, APC is a plaintiff's law firm based in Los Angeles, specializing in employment law. Our 14 attorney firm is growing very rapidly, and the right candidate will have unique advancement opportunities. In short, if you end up being a star, you will advance quickly and your long-term prospects will be tremendous. We are looking to immediately hire a junior associate for our wage and hour class action department.

We place a huge emphasis on attorney growth and happiness. No one in our office will be barking orders at you, and everyone has a pretty awesome personality. We give our associates real responsibilities, and the attorneys for these positions will be trained to soon manage their own cases under the supervision of one of the senior attorneys. We are looking for someone that can grow with the firm.

Job Description:

We are seeking a dynamic and motivated Class Action Associate to join our team. As a member of our firm, you will have the opportunity to represent victims of wage theft on a classwide basis as it relates to unpaid overtime, meal and rest breaks, unreimbursed expenses and more. You will play a pivotal role in providing legal counsel, drafting legal documents, taking/defending depositions and advocating for our clients both in and out of the courtroom. This is the perfect opportunity to get experience and exposure in state and federal plaintiffs-side class action litigation against regional, national, and Fortune 500 companies in multiple industries. You will truly be fighting for the little guy.

We’re seeking a strategic and highly experienced Employment Law Partner to join one of California’s most respected and forward-thinking employment defense firms. This leadership role is ideal for an accomplished attorney with deep expertise in PAGA claims, class action litigation, and California labor law compliance.

As a Partner, you will oversee and manage complex litigation matters, including representative actions and class claims, while developing and executing legal strategies that protect and advance client interests. You will also play a key role in advising employers on compliance, internal policies, and risk management to help them navigate California’s evolving employment landscape.

With a remote-first approach with a conservative on-site presence, this position offers the flexibility modern attorneys value while keeping you connected to top-tier colleagues and clients across the state. With multiple offices in Southern and Northern California (including Orange County, Los Angeles, and Sacramento), you’ll have the support of a respected infrastructure while practicing with autonomy and purpose.

The firm is built on a collaborative culture, a diverse and engaged legal team, and a performance-based bonus program that rewards both productivity and results. You’ll be empowered to lead litigation teams, guide clients through high-stakes matters, and mentor junior attorneys.

Job Title: Employment Law Partner

Location: Orange County, Los Angeles County, or Sacramento, CA

Core Responsibilities:

  • Manage and oversee PAGA claims, including class action-style lawsuits, ensuring strategic development, legal filings, and representation in settlement negotiations or trial.
  • Develop and execute legal strategies tailored to PAGA claims, balancing risk, settlement potential, and litigation costs.
  • Monitor and manage the discovery process, working with teams to gather evidence, deposing key witnesses, and preparing for hearings or trials.
  • Provide counsel on compliance with California labor laws, conduct audits, and advise clients on best practices to mitigate PAGA risks and prevent future claims.
  • Assist clients in developing and implementing policies related to wage and hour issues, employee classification, and meal/rest break compliance.
  • Evaluate and advise on the impact of new legislation or case law affecting PAGA claims, ensuring clients stay ahead of regulatory changes.
  • Foster and expand client relationships, offer ongoing legal support, and identify opportunities for business development within the PAGA practice area.
  • Develop and deliver presentations, workshops, or training on PAGA compliance and litigation to current and prospective clients.
  • Cultivate new client leads through networking, industry events, and leveraging the firm’s reputation in employment law.
  • Supervise and mentor junior attorneys and staff, ensuring high-quality work and providing guidance on PAGA-related legal matters.
  • Review and approve legal work, including motions, pleadings, and discovery responses, to ensure compliance and quality.
  • Foster a collaborative work environment, encouraging professional growth and ensuring that team members stay up-to-date with PAGA developments and strategies.
